Reached up a long tree-lined driveway this beautiful property provides the perfect getaway for families and larger groups. Once you enter you'll never want to leave but if you can drag yourself away then there a day trips aplenty on the doorstep. Robin Hood's Bay or Whitby with its historic Abbey and blue flag beach are about an hours drive away. Alternatively a day out in York provides something for everyone with fabulous shopping, the stunning cathedral, Railway Museum or Jorvik Viking Centre just a few of the great places to visit. Within walking distance from the property, through the private wood, is a path leading to Yorkshire Air Museum & Allied Forces Memorial. Also just a short distance away is the York Maze, the largest maze in the UK.

An imposing entrance hall welcomes you to into the house, venture to the left and you'll find the formal drawing room with plenty of fun board games, pool table, small football table and Bagatelle board to enjoy. Kick off your shoes and sink into the comfortable Chesterfield sofas in front of the impressive open fire, listen to some music on the radio and record player. To the right, you will find the hub of the house, a fabulous open-plan lounge/kitchen/dining area. The kitchen area is well-equipped with two electric ovens and a 5 burner induction hob, steamer oven, built in microwave, two dishwashers, larder drink fridge with ice compartment, coffee machine, blender, island and breakfast bar and spoils you with underfloor heating. There is a cosy seating area in front of the woodburner under the large skylight, where you can enjoy afternoon tea and plan your adventures or simply enjoy watching a film on the Smart TV and DVD with surround sound. Leading through the archway takes you to the formal dining area where you can enjoy a lovely meal, where there is also a door to the garden. A large utility room can be found off the kitchen with an American style fridge/freezer with water and ice dispenser, washing machine and tumble dryer. Heading back to the entrance hall you will find a separate WC and staircase leading up to the first floor. The first floor consists of two king-size bedrooms, the blue room having a white metal bed, dual aspect windows looking out over the garden, this has access to the bathroom which can used as an en-suite. The gold King-size bedroom is under the low'ish beam, a further twin bed room, the green room with Smart TV and completing the bedrooms is the blue zip & link superking (which can be split into a twin on request), also with Smart TV). There are two bathrooms on this floor, one bathroom with shower over the freestanding bath and WC (which can be locked off and used as an ensuite bathroom to the adjacent king-size bedroom) and a large shower room with rainfall shower with WC.

Heading outside there is an extensive fully enclosed garden complete with outdoor WIFI, summer house with patio area and garden furniture for al fresco dining and two charcoal BBQs for those warm summer evenings. The garden also has a fire pit with seating, ideal for toasting marshmallows and enjoying those clear night skies. There is also outdoor table tennis and lots of other garden games available for you to use. There is ample off-road parking for up to 6 cars on the driveway.  Access to 3.5 private wood, The Old Plantation, which features WW2 remnants and offers a short cut to the Yorkshire Air Museum.
